The Foundation: Understanding the Tuxedo Aesthetic

Think of this loadout like a formal suit. The goal is a perfect balance of black and white, with perhaps a touch of silver for "accessories." We're looking for skins with clean designs, sharp contrasts, and minimal color bleed. The focus is on patterns that use negative space, crisp geometric designs, or iconic monochrome finishes. A low float (preferably Factory New or Minimal Wear) is non-negotiable here—scratches and wear ruin the pristine look we're after.

The Essential Weapon Skins: Your Monochrome Arsenal

This is where your loadout comes to life. We've broken down the must-haves by role and visual impact.

The Primary Powerhouses

Your rifles and AWPs are the centerpieces. They need to be iconic.

  • AK-47 | Nightwish: The undisputed king. Its swirling, elegant black-and-white art deco pattern is the definition of tuxedo chic. A Factory New StatTrak version is the ultimate flex.
  • M4A4 | In Living Color: Don't let the name fool you. The white base with sharp, graffiti-style black scribbles is a modern, edgy take on the theme. It's bold and impossible to ignore.
  • AWP | Black Nile: For a more subtle, sleek look. The deep black finish with intricate white Egyptian hieroglyphics offers a mysterious and refined vibe. Pair it with a clean scope like the Desert Hydra or Fade for contrast.
  • M4A1-S | Printstream: The classic. A pearlescent white body with slick black decals. It's clean, futuristic, and always in style. This is a cornerstone skin for any monochrome collection.

Secondary & Close-Quarters Class

These skins complete the ensemble and show your attention to detail.

  • Desert Eagle | Printstream: The perfect sidearm companion to the M4A1-S. That same flawless white and black scheme on CS2's most satisfying pistol.
  • USP-S | Whiteout: The name says it all. A brilliant, almost blinding white finish. Getting a low-float Factory New one is a challenge, but it's the purest expression of the white side of your loadout.
  • Glock-18 | Moonrise: A stunning, more artistic option. A black slide over a galaxy-like white and silver body. It adds a touch of cosmic flair while staying within the palette.

Gloves & Knife: The Final Accents

No tuxedo is complete without the right accessories. This is what elevates your loadout from "great" to "god-tier."

Gloves: Your Signature Style

  • Sport Gloves | Pandora's Box: The ultimate black-and-white statement glove. The complex, painted design in monochrome is arguably the best fit for this theme, period.
  • Driver Gloves | Snow Leopard: For a cleaner, more minimalist look. The soft white base with subtle black speckling is incredibly elegant and pairs with everything.
  • Moto Gloves | Eclipse: A more affordable but iconic option. The deep, solid black with the white knuckle pad is simple, tough, and perfectly coordinated.

The Knife: The Centerpiece

Your knife is your jewel. For a Tuxedo loadout, you want finishes that are primarily black, white, or silver.

  • Karambit | Gamma Doppler Phase 2 (Emerald-like): While a true Emerald is green, a P2 with a large, bright cyan/green tip can read as a brilliant silver or ice against the black, creating a stunning contrast.
  • Any Knife | Damascus Steel: The folded metal look provides a gorgeous silver-and-black swirling pattern. It's metallic, sophisticated, and uniquely textured.
  • Any Knife | Black Laminate: Pure, understated darkness. The wood and black steel finish is all business and looks incredibly sharp with white gloves.
  • M9 Bayonet | Marble Fade (Blue/Red Tip): Seek out a "fake ice & fire" or blue-dominant pattern. The white marble base with bold blue and red/black tips fits the high-contrast theme spectacularly.
